Designing Real-Time Systems on SMP Architecture

ªL®Û³Ç (K.-J. Lin), Professor, Dept of ECE, University of California, Irvine, USA

Abstract

Large real-time multimedia systems such as flight simulators have adopted multiprocessor architecture to handle the large amount of events and computations. Existing real-time scheduling algorithms designed for single-processor systems such as Rate Monotonic (RM) and Earliest Deadline First Algorithm (EDF) have very poor performance on multiprocessor systems. Moreover, on-line scheduling algorithms for multiprocessor systems also have poor schedulability conditions for real-time applications. In this talk, we present different ways to design real-time applications on SMP machines.
